Commit Graph

79 Commits

Author SHA1 Message Date
Allen Byrne
243cf5ce6c [svn-r20899] Add soversion handling - use config/lt_vers.am file.
Bring r20895 from 1.8
2011-05-25 09:57:16 -05:00
Allen Byrne
089e81e86a [svn-r20862] Adjust CPack configuration location by removing version extension in folder name. Add install configuration commands if ext libs are packaged with project. 2011-05-18 12:50:32 -05:00
Allen Byrne
29411fc602 [svn-r20853] Add CPack commands to properly include extlibs into package
Tested: windows
2011-05-17 17:12:36 -05:00
Allen Byrne
05ee8cdd18 [svn-r20808] Add Using_CMake.txt file to docs and install 2011-05-13 09:11:52 -05:00
Allen Byrne
2ee1841187 [svn-r20721] Refactor ext lib import and install.
Add SOVERSION for linux
2011-05-04 14:42:03 -05:00
Allen Byrne
ece690cdb6 [svn-r20717] Refactor ext lib import and install.
Change case of tools subtests to not conflict with tools tests.

Tested: windows, local linux
2011-05-04 11:18:22 -05:00
Allen Byrne
907a5a1df0 [svn-r20713] Packed Bits Merge:
removed option defines and #ifdef/#endif
   refactored all printf to HDfprintf in h5dump.c
   formatted and indention improvements
   synched with 1.8 branch
   
Tested: local linux
2011-05-03 12:56:23 -05:00
Allen Byrne
9e73c8ee3d [svn-r20641] Add CPack overrides for NSIS install paths. Install for products are: HDF Group/Product/Version
Tested: windows , local linux
2011-04-26 14:13:01 -05:00
Allen Byrne
b120aff5cf [svn-r20590] On windows the ext libs did not work for cpack process. Changed ext lib handling to get the correct path. Needs more work to remove the the pre-install copying. 2011-04-21 14:20:23 -05:00
Allen Byrne
27be7d1e2d [svn-r20572] Bug #5929: On windows check for existence of InitOnceExecuteOnce for use by threads.
merge from 1.8 r20568
2011-04-20 13:17:25 -05:00
Allen Byrne
a835d1e65a [svn-r20472] Add message that H5_HAVE_WIN_THREADS requires WINVER >= 0x600 (VISTA or WIN7) 2011-04-11 15:52:09 -05:00
Allen Byrne
09a7dad099 [svn-r20391] Add overlooked condition for external project around packaging section of extlibs 2011-04-01 13:38:31 -05:00
Allen Byrne
378dc5ec28 [svn-r20335] Remove unused windows defines. Add _CONSOLE to windows definitions. 2011-03-25 13:35:07 -05:00
Allen Byrne
ac3b230f0b [svn-r20239] Add HDFGroup to PACKAGE_NAME, as parent folder name for CPack installation configuration. 2011-03-14 11:49:31 -05:00
Allen Byrne
251a65e448 [svn-r20155] Change macros - do not need URL parameter 2011-02-24 15:59:27 -05:00
Allen Byrne
05dfc85de8 [svn-r20153] Move ext lib handling for ext project building to a common macro. Update HDF5 project to use HDFMacros.cmake file. Add test properties for test ordering.
Tested: local linux, windows
2011-02-24 14:43:07 -05:00
Allen Byrne
be50f4a424 [svn-r20151] On windows the name of static zlib library is dependent on the use of HDF_LEGACY_NAMING value when built from SVN/TGZ source. 2011-02-24 06:57:56 -05:00
Allen Byrne
85304e9fee [svn-r20149] Change Name of Legacy naming option 2011-02-23 15:09:55 -05:00
Allen Byrne
5d320f5c89 [svn-r20141] Bring 1.8 r20139 cmake and windows changes to trunk 2011-02-22 09:55:04 -05:00
Allen Byrne
0a15d73625 [svn-r20013] Change use of variable to allow a SITE name to be defined, to using it to extend the build name used in reporting to CDash 2011-01-27 09:59:04 -05:00
Allen Byrne
762ee14a42 [svn-r20002] Add variable to allow a SITE name to be defined
Tested: local linux
2011-01-26 16:00:09 -05:00
Allen Byrne
bf8f584a72 [svn-r19999] Correct typo in check for external library TGZ path define
Tested: local linux
2011-01-26 12:11:23 -05:00
Allen Byrne
c5dd29c7b8 [svn-r19993] Added ability to use compressed file for external libraries corrected.
Tested: local linux
2011-01-25 16:17:54 -05:00
Allen Byrne
e2ff4638f5 [svn-r19991] Added ability to use compressed file for external libraries
Tested: local linux
2011-01-25 15:40:41 -05:00
Allen Byrne
a22b5883b9 [svn-r19949] Correct CPack confusion with the same for two different functions (not case-sensitive) 2011-01-13 14:21:12 -05:00
Allen Byrne
8eb9d884e3 [svn-r19921] Update files for CPack use. 2011-01-06 14:28:19 -05:00
Allen Byrne
1c7688c77a [svn-r19896] remove orphaned endif() 2010-12-30 07:32:07 -05:00
Allen Byrne
86313eb281 [svn-r19895] Remove use of /MT compile flag for building static libs and programs. Added BUILT_AS_STATIC_LIBRARY define to set the windows import/export defines correctly for static libraries. 2010-12-29 13:52:34 -05:00
Allen Byrne
60b5523f8d [svn-r19886] Correct name of file document for Cpack install. 2010-12-13 10:33:18 -05:00
Allen Byrne
624ab27d38 [svn-r19878] Correct HDF5 configuration variables for CPack/Install.
Bring r19875 from 1.8 branch
2010-12-08 15:55:25 -05:00
Allen Byrne
109294e6e2 [svn-r19865] Correct INSTALL_PREFIX handling 2010-12-02 09:31:40 -05:00
Allen Byrne
f8b3d669da [svn-r19854] Correct external library generated headers packing for install/cpack when not using svn builds 2010-11-27 13:38:51 -05:00
Allen Byrne
51fd60955b [svn-r19852] Add back dropped during edit - create directory - for external projects in cpack. 2010-11-26 12:27:53 -05:00
Allen Byrne
8c1b4bc3c7 [svn-r19845] Correct external library generated headers packing for install/cpack 2010-11-25 11:51:40 -05:00
Allen Byrne
f18d822ca5 [svn-r19843] Remove quotes from BLDTYPE parameter in building external projects from svn
Tested: Windows
2010-11-25 10:33:31 -05:00
Allen Byrne
0918e92000 [svn-r19841] Correct external library packing for install/cpack. On windows using shared libs, dlls still needed to be put in the runtime folder for tests. 2010-11-24 11:29:50 -05:00
Allen Byrne
5ab92a43a3 [svn-r19837] Correct external library packing for install/cpack
Tested: Windows
2010-11-23 16:05:39 -05:00
Allen Byrne
186d01285a [svn-r19790] CMake: Correct Error tests. Add Deprecated Symbols option.
Tested: local linux
2010-11-16 11:38:40 -05:00
Allen Byrne
cd7057b21c [svn-r19782] Fix CMake testing for links_env test which requires an environment variable at test run-time. Modified runTest.cmake file to allow optional ENV_VAR and ENV_VALUE to be passed. runTest.cmake requires a reference file, added links_env.out to testfiles folder.
Also updated root CMakeLists.txt to output a message when unsopported options are configured with the PARALLEL option. CMake will still generate files.

Tested: windows and local linux
2010-11-15 11:35:29 -05:00
Allen Byrne
1c45b0eeb5 [svn-r19726] [BZ2072]Add compare output to expected test for help and version options of mkgrp.
Tested: local linux
2010-11-04 15:51:05 -05:00
Allen Byrne
4c38f3fdc7 [svn-r19717] Correct external lib handling for Windows 2010-11-02 16:55:20 -05:00
Allen Byrne
2b0d8d59ae [svn-r19706] Added VFD test options.
Bring r19705 from branch
2010-11-01 17:10:50 -05:00
Allen Byrne
1f27dc4d04 [svn-r19674] MPI_ checks were failing due to wrong #include of mpi.h in cmake setup
From Community
2010-10-27 10:48:57 -05:00
Allen Byrne
9f6fb53aa6 [svn-r19613] Add option command to set flags OFF for if not using ExternalProjects 2010-10-15 13:16:53 -05:00
Allen Byrne
3e7926a35b [svn-r19610] Add missing XXX_USE_EXTERNAL flags for ExternalProjects 2010-10-15 10:32:47 -05:00
Allen Byrne
5f74116522 [svn-r19607] Add message when ExternalProject is built 2010-10-15 09:50:33 -05:00
Allen Byrne
2342d695dc [svn-r19580] Correct target format in ADD_DEPENCIES command 2010-10-12 09:17:15 -05:00
Allen Byrne
293e541644 [svn-r19573] Adjust external library names depending on build type for ExternalProject Command
Tested: local linux, windows
2010-10-11 15:36:03 -05:00
Allen Byrne
91029a6dba [svn-r19570] Parameterize SVN URLs.
Add ExternalProject dependicies of external libs copy on project build.
Force ExternalProject Libs to build release.

Tested: local linux
2010-10-11 10:11:46 -05:00
Allen Byrne
bd9a9e8f4a [svn-r19534] Add using-memchecker option 2010-10-07 11:05:41 -05:00